From: Milan Broz <mbroz@redhat.com>

commit 18068bdd5f59229623b2fa518a6389e346642b0d upstream.

Veritysetup is now part of cryptsetup package.
Remove on-disk header description (which is not parsed in kernel)
and point users to cryptsetup where it the format is documented.
Mention units for block size paramaters.
Fix target line specification and dmsetup parameters.

 Theory of operation
 ===================
 
-dm-verity is meant to be setup as part of a verified boot path.  This
+dm-verity is meant to be set up as part of a verified boot path.  This
 may be anything ranging from a boot using tboot or trustedgrub to just
 booting from a known-good device (like a USB drive or CD).
 
@@ -73,20 +73,20 @@ When a dm-verity device is configured, i
 has been authenticated in some way (cryptographic signatures, etc).
 After instantiation, all hashes will be verified on-demand during
 disk access.  If they cannot be verified up to the root node of the
-tree, the root hash, then the I/O will fail.  This should identify
+tree, the root hash, then the I/O will fail.  This should detect
 tampering with any data on the device and the hash data.
 
 Cryptographic hashes are used to assert the integrity of the device on a
-per-block basis.  This allows for a lightweight hash computation on first read
-into the page cache.  Block hashes are stored linearly-aligned to the nearest
-block the size of a page.
+per-block basis. This allows for a lightweight hash computation on first read
+into the page cache. Block hashes are stored linearly, aligned to the nearest
+block size.
 
 Hash Tree
 ---------
 
 Each node in the tree is a cryptographic hash.  If it is a leaf node, the hash
-is of some block data on disk.  If it is an intermediary node, then the hash is
-of a number of child nodes.
+of some data block on disk is calculated. If it is an intermediary node,
+the hash of a number of child nodes is calculated.
 
 Each entry in the tree is a collection of neighboring nodes that fit in one
 block.  The number is determined based on block_size and the size of the
